Current Rental Prices and Market Overview

Rental prices in Dobsonville are competitive, making the area especially attractive for budget-conscious renters.

  • Average room rent: A single room typically rents for around R2,500 per month as of June 2025[1].
  • 1-bedroom flats average about R2,500; two-bedroom and three-bedroom options are priced at R4,700 and R7,150 respectively, depending on location and amenities.
  • Rental market stability: Prices have shown modest increases year-over-year, reflecting growing demand and maintained affordability[1].
Room Type Avg. Rent (June 2025)
Single Room R2,500
1 Bedroom R2,500
2 Bedrooms R4,700
3 Bedrooms R7,150

What to Expect: Amenities and Community Life

Dobsonville provides both essential and lifestyle amenities, ensuring a comfortable and engaging living experience.

Key local features:

  • Shopping: Dobsonville Mall and various convenience stores serve as daily shopping hubs.
  • Transport: Minibus taxis, Rea Vaya, and bus routes make transit straightforward and affordable.
  • Healthcare: Several clinics and pharmacies are available in the neighborhood.
  • Education: Numerous primary and secondary schools support families and students.
  • Parks & Recreation: Sports grounds, parks, and community centers offer recreation options for all ages.

Tips for Renters: Dos, Don’ts, and Safety

Stay protected and make informed decisions during your rental search with these essential tips:

  • Do:
    • Inspect the property before signing a lease or making any payments.
    • Request a written rental agreement detailing terms, responsibilities, and deposit conditions.
    • Verify the landlord or agent’s credentials.
    • Confirm utilities included in the rent (water, electricity, Wi-Fi).
  • Don’t:
    • Don’t send money before viewing the property.
    • Don’t rely solely on photos; insist on a walkthrough or video call if you’re remote.
    • Don’t ignore red flags, such as missing paperwork or pressure for immediate payment.
  • Safety first: Meet in public places when possible, inform someone of your appointments, and be aware of local rental scams.

1. What is the average monthly rent for a room in Dobsonville?
The average is R2,500 per month for a single room as of June 2025, but prices vary based on size and location[1][4][7].

2. How do I know if a rental listing is legitimate?
Always visit the property in person, meet the landlord, and avoid paying deposits before signing a lease. Trusted local platforms like dobsonville.co.za offer verified listings.

3. Are rentals generally furnished or unfurnished?
Most rooms are unfurnished, but some landlords offer basic furniture for an additional fee. Always confirm this detail before committing.

4. What amenities can I expect in a typical Dobsonville rental?
Common amenities include secure access, private or shared bathrooms, and proximity to public transport, shops, and schools. Some rentals offer Wi-Fi or inclusive utilities.

5. How much deposit is usually required?
A deposit equivalent to one month’s rent is standard, but always get receipt and agreement documentation.

6. Are there any agencies or organizations that can help mediate rental disputes?
Yes, the Rental Housing Tribunal offers free mediation services for tenants and landlords.
